Edycja: Naprawiono to wtedy, gdy łatka została wdrożona z dodaniem konfiguracji VPN. Nie używaj już Linuksa / Ubuntu.
Zainstalowałem Menedżera sieci OpenVPN, wykonując sudo apt-get install network-manager-openvpn
:, który również instaluje pakiet gnome.
Umożliwiło to importowanie konfiguracji w 13.10, ale podczas mojej nowej instalacji mogę wskazać .conf
pliki, ale po kliknięciu importu menedżer po prostu znika i żadne połączenie nie jest dodawane.
Próbowałem ręcznie ustawić, który to działał, ale moje połączenie po pewnym czasie spada, chyba dlatego, że nie ustawiłem ręcznie ostatniego szczegółu bardzo szczegółowej konfiguracji.
Łączenie się przez terminal poprzez: sudo openvpn --config /path/to/openvpn.conf
poprosił mnie o nazwę użytkownika, następnie hasło, ale potem się nie łączy.
Co mogę zrobić, aby to naprawić? Naprawdę potrzebuję mojej sieci VPN, każda pomoc jest bardzo ceniona.
Edycja: To błąd / 1294899
W przypadku kolejki ponownego otwierania: Ktoś ma do tego bardzo dobre obejście i użył edycji, aby to umieścić, ale jest to warte własnej odpowiedzi: głosowanie w celu ponownego otwarcia ...
Odpowiedzi:
Masz rację, to błąd menedżera sieci. Ale ja (i ty też) mogę to obejść, uruchamiając openvpn z wiersza poleceń. Prawdopodobnie wykonałeś co najmniej kilka z tych kroków, ale na wszelki wypadek (i dla innych) zrobię krok po kroku.
Najpierw zainstaluj wymagane pakiety
Utwórz pliki Te pliki muszą być zawsze bezpieczne i prywatne
<ca>
i</ca>
z client.ovpn do tego pliku<cert>
i</cert>
z client.ovpn do tego pliku<key>
i</key>
z client.ovpn do tego pliku<tls-auth>
i</tls-auth>
z client.ovpn do tego pliku W tym momencie mam w sumie 6 plików w moim katalogu openvpn (w tym plik kopii zapasowej)5-9 Właśnie opracowałem skrypt bash. Whoop Skopiuj następujące pliki tekstowe:
Plik zapisałem jako openvpnconvert w folderze openvpn wraz z plikiem client.ovpn. Uczyniono go wykonywalnym za pomocą polecenia chmod a + x:
A potem uruchomiłem:
Zmodyfikuj plik client.ovpn
Tuż przed linią ## —–BEGIN RSA SIGNATURE—– dodaj poniższe linie i zapisz
Na koniec musisz uruchomić openvpn z interfejsu wiersza poleceń (CLI)
cd do folderu openvpn
Uruchom openvpn, jeśli używasz określonych przeze mnie nazw plików, patrz poniżej, w przeciwnym razie użyj swoich nazw plików.
Obecnie korzystam z OpenVPN, który skonfigurowałem, wykonując dokładnie te kroki. Mam nadzieję, że działa równie dobrze dla innych.
Źródła:
Tworzenie plików - http://naveensnayak.wordpress.com/2013/03/04/ubuntu-openvpn-with-ovpn-file/
Uruchamianie z wiersza poleceń - http://ubuntuforums.org/showthread.php?t=2206811
źródło
Myślałem, że tej opcji brakuje, ale po prostu się zmieniła. Najpierw wybierz dodaj połączenie, a następnie zamiast OpenVPN (jak to robiłem), przewiń w dół i wybierz ostatnią opcję „importuj zapisaną VPN ...”
znalazłem odpowiedź tutaj - http://torguard.net/knowledgebase.php?action=displayarticle&id=53
źródło
Nigdy nie próbowałem importować tych danych połączenia, ale przy różnych okazjach korzystałem z następujących opcji:
umieść
whatever.conf
razem z.crt
plikiem i poświadczeniami/etc/openvpn
i uruchom / zatrzymaj połączenie VPN zsudo service openvpn whatever start|stop
utwórz połączenie VPN za pomocą Menedżera sieci, wprowadzając ręcznie dane połączenia. Plik konfiguracyjny połączenia zostanie umieszczony
/etc/NetworkManager/system-connections
i można go później edytować.źródło
Skrypt ekstrakcyjny:
W odpowiedzi na pomocną odpowiedź Tamsyna Michaela stworzyłem mały program do automatyzacji zadania ekstrakcji. Wysyła odpowiednie pliki potrzebne do openvpn, a następnie dołącza te nazwy plików do oryginalnego pliku ustawień.
Kompilacja i budowanie:
Aby to zbudować, musisz zainstalować g ++
Następnie z terminala
W folderze pojawi się program „certgrabber”.
Wykorzystanie programu:
Wypakuj do domyślnych nazw plików (ca.crt, client.crt, client.key, tls-auth.key)
Wyodrębnij do niestandardowych nazw plików
źródło
Problem z DODAWANIEM VPN z zapisanego pliku .ovpn nadal kończy się niepowodzeniem.
Można dodać jeden ręcznie.
Wpisz PORT (w pliku .ovpn, zwykle u dołu po adresie IP w pozycji „XX”:
zdalne ###. ###. ##. ## XX
Jeśli twoją siecią VPN jest TCP, zaznacz pole „Użyj połączenia TCP”
W tym momencie połączenie VPN powinno być opcjonalnie wymienione w NM AppIndicator. Wybierz i przetestuj połączenie. Byłem w stanie dodać połączenie typu TCP i UDP, ale zajęło mi to o wiele więcej niż byłoby, gdyby zadziałał importowany plik .ovpn.
Mam nadzieję, że wkrótce to naprawią, dzięki czemu mogę łatwo dodać inne połączenie ... ale przynajmniej jest to praca, która powinna pomóc ludziom sfrustrowanym tak jak ja.
źródło
Stworzyłem skrypt tutaj zautomatyzować pobieranie hasło i pliki zip z kilku miejsc, takich jak VPN vpnbook.com , ekstrakcję
ca
,cert
orazkey
dane z ovpn plików i aktualizacji opvn plików więc certs powinny importować tylko dla ciebie. Można go łatwo zmodyfikować do użytku z innymi dostawcami.źródło